Listings commonly use labels like “All Hair Types,” “Thick,” and “Normal,” plus specific notes such as “Perfect for fine hair” or “Designed for fine to thin hair.” These short tags help shoppers match ties to their hair texture.
Review summaries frequently report strong hold and good durability: many users say the ties hold hair securely, stay put during activity, and retain shape for many uses before stretching.
Suggested ages on packs vary and include labels such as “All Ages,” “10 Years and Up,” “18 Years and Up,” and “Adult Use Only,” depending on the listing.
Listings include widths and dimensions such as 2 mm and 4 mm widths, a 140 mm circumference, and a 2.25" diameter in some packs.
Common anti-damage features are no-metal/seamless construction, cloth-covered or seamless designs that avoid grommets, and product descriptions stating the elastics won’t pull, snag, or break hair.
Packs are available in solid basics like black and in assorted color mixes. Example assortments shown include Pink, Mustard, Sky Blue, and Navy, among other color mixes.
